# Broker upgrade notes (welcome aboard!)

We're moving PipeCrow from the old 3.x broker to the new Larkspur engine, and you'll be driving most of the migration. Don't panic — the consumers are all idempotent, so replays are safe. Drain each shard before flipping it, and watch the lag graph in Spyglass while you do. The new broker refuses anonymous connections, which is a nice change honestly. So your env file for each worker needs the broker credential secret appended as the very next line:

sealed setting: ARCHIVE_KEY3=8d0

## Break-Glass: Hot-Reload Config (Fennet Gateway)

Hot-reloading on Fennet normally goes through the Larkspur deploy pipeline. If the pipeline is down and a config push is urgent, break-glass applies: SSH to the config node, run the reload daemon manually, and log the action in the incident channel. The daemon prompts for the break-glass recovery passphrase before accepting a manual reload; it is shown below.

unlock words, yawig-kagef: gordor-holvan-ulaael-pramir-ulaiel-tamdor

// Broker client setup — Corvid 3.2 migration
//
// Release manager notes: this block initializes the Thrushline
// client against the upgraded Corvid 3.2 broker. The old SASL
// handshake is gone; 3.2 requires token auth on connect, so the
// legacy config path is dead code and slated for removal next
// cut. Connection pool size stays at 8 until soak tests finish.
// The client authenticates with the internal key directly below.

gateway credential: kto3_qfe

Handover — Vexler partner SFTP drop

Ownership moves to you today. Drop runs hourly from Vexler's end into the intake bucket via the relay host. Watch for zero-byte files; their exporter flakes on Mondays. Creds live in the ops vault, path noted in the runbook. Vault auto-seals after 48h idle. Support escalations go to the on-call rotation, not me. If the vault is sealed when you need it, unseal with the recovery passphrase below.

recovery phrase for tadug-fafof: zorwyn-kasion